Full Data Comparison
| Metric | Anaheim, CA | Erie, PA |
|---|---|---|
| 💰 Cost of Living | ||
| Cost of Living Index National avg = 100 · lower = cheaper | 115.5⚠ High | 91.5 ✓ Cheaper |
| Median Home Value | $713,600⚠ High | $101,500 ✓ Lower |
| Median Monthly Rent | $1,958⚠ High | $809 ✓ Lower |
| 📈 Income & Economy | ||
| Median Household Income | $88,538 ✓ Higher | $43,135 |
| Unemployment Rate | 5.4%⚠ High ✓ Lower | 6.8%⚠ High |
| Avg Commute Minutes each way | 28.4 min⚠ High | 18.2 min ✓ Shorter |
| Work From Home % | 7.8% ✓ Higher | 5.8% |
| 🔒 Safety | ||
| Crime Index 100 = national avg · lower = safer · 60% violent / 40% property | 135⚠ High | 96 ✓ Safer |
| Violent Crime Index 100 = national avg · lower = safer | 157⚠ High | 99 ✓ Safer |
| Property Crime Index 100 = national avg · lower = safer | 102⚠ High | 92 ✓ Safer |
| 🎓 Education | ||
| School Quality 100 = national avg · grad rate, staffing & attainment | C- (74) | B- (90) ✓ Better |
| Student-Teacher Ratio Lower = smaller classes | 23.0:1 | 12.9:1 ✓ Smaller |
| Bachelor's Degree or Higher | 28.1% ✓ Higher | 22.4% |
| High School or Higher | 77.8% | 88.6% ✓ Higher |
| School District Name only — no quality rating available | Anaheim Elementary | Erie City SD |
| 🌤 Weather | ||
| Avg High — January | 71.0°F ✓ Warmer | 35.2°F |
| Avg High — July | 86.8°F ✓ Warmer | 81.1°F |
| Annual Precipitation | 14.2" ✓ Drier | 43.0" |
| Annual Snowfall | 0.0" ✓ Less | 104.3" |
| 👥 Demographics | ||
| Population | 347,111 ✓ Larger | 94,826 |
| Median Age | 35.4 ✓ Older | 35.0 |
| Homeownership Rate | 46.6% | 52.6% ✓ Higher |
| Under 18 | 22.9% ✓ More | 21.4% |
| Over 65 | 12.2% | 15.5% ✓ More |
